Saorge lies above the Roya gorges and is arranged like an amphitheatre on the mountainside, having once been a fortress. The medieval character of the village is reflected in its maze of alleyways and vaulted passages. The Nice–Cuneo railway line has a stop called “Fontan-Saorge”; from there, it is a 20-minute walk.

Culture
The Saorge Monastery is a former Franciscan monastery and a remarkable example of Baroque architecture. Visitors can explore the monastery independently and also discover its terraced garden. The complex includes a cloister decorated with 18th-century frescoes and an exceptional ensemble of nine sundials.
The Church of Saint-Sauveur is a Baroque church with trompe-l’œil columns and a high altar featuring marble inlays. It also has a fully restored Italian-style organ, which is regularly played at concerts and religious events.
The Madone del Poggio Chapel is a building of early Romanesque art with frescoes and a seven-storey bell tower in the Lombard style. It is privately owned, but can be visited on certain days of the year, particularly during the Journées du Patrimoine.
Malmort Castle is a fortification that survives today as a ruin. It has been mentioned since the 13th century and was restored in the 17th century. Saorge is also an important stop on the “Route du Baroque et des orgues historiques de la Vallée de la Roya”.
Nature
Bain du Sémite is a natural bathing pool on the Bendola. Flat rocks serve as places for sunbathing and swimming in summer. The middle section of the Bendola Gorge can also be walked from Saorge in a day and includes longer swimming sections.
The hike to the Croix du mont Agu begins at the Madone de Poggio sanctuary in Saorge, at an altitude of 480 metres. From the hamlet of Cayrosine in Saorge, a path also leads to the ruins of Malmort Castle at an altitude of 832 metres.
